IS IT YOUR GLANDS?

  Saw a post about excess testosterone possibly being cause of weight gain, also speculation about polycystic ovary syndrome, abdominal weight, etc. It is NOT ALWAYS AN EXCUSE. Some people do have medical issues.  By the time I was finally able to get doctors to listen to me, I was huge and had suffered a heart attack and irreparable emotional damage.  In addition to excess testosterone, I was found to be severely hypothyroid. That's all water under the bridge now.  Even with endocrine help, I know I must continue the calorie fight as long as I live.
